Spanish federation to sue Canal+
THE Spanish tennis federation (RFET) plans to sue French TV broadcaster Canal+ over a sketch which appeared to imply world No. 2 Rafael Nadal and his fellow Spanish athletes are drug cheats.
The sketch from the show "Les Guignols", or "The Puppets", shows a life-size likeness of Nadal filling up his car's gas tank from his own bladder before being pulled over by traffic police for speeding. "Spanish athletes. They do not win by chance," is flashed on the screen surrounded by the logo of the RFET and several other Spanish federations, including soccer and cycling.
